The Economics of Payroll Float

Understanding Pre-Funding Cycles

Standard payroll creates natural float that most business owners never optimize:

Typical Biweekly Timeline:

  • Day 1-2: Payroll processing, hours verified

  • Day 3-4: Employer funds payroll account

  • Day 5: Official payday, employee deposits

This 2-5 day gap exists across virtually every payment structure. For a 500-employee company with $60K average salaries, that creates $575,000 in constant float every two weeks.

According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, 43% of private sector businesses use biweekly schedules. Traditional payroll infrastructure treats pre-funding as necessary friction, money sits earning 0.4-0.5% in business accounts until disbursement.

How Stablecoin Payroll Transforms Float

Programmable Money Infrastructure

Stablecoin payroll systems make money programmable by default. Instead of static deposits, funds become productive capital instantly.

The Technical Flow:

  1. Employer funds payroll (USDC/stablecoins)

  2. Funds auto-deploy to DeFi lending protocols (Aave, Drift, Compound)

  3. Yield accrues continuously until disbursement

  4. Employees receive full scheduled salary

  5. Employer captures yield during float

The innovation: employees experience zero changes to compensation or timing. Yield generation happens entirely on the employer side during natural delays.

Why This Isn't Mainstream Yet

The Infrastructure Barriers

Three factors prevent widespread adoption:

Technical Complexit: Integrating stablecoin payroll requires evaluating protocols, managing smart contracts, and abstracting complexity—challenges traditional payroll companies can't handle.

Regulatory Uncertainty: The GENIUS Act (signed July 2025) provides clear federal regulatory framework with 100% reserve backing requirements and monthly transparency, substantially reducing compliance risks.

Custody Concerns: Early DeFi required custody transfer to third-party contracts, unacceptable for payroll obligations. Modern infrastructure solves this through custody-agnostic architectures.

Risk Management

De-Pegging Concerns

Major stablecoins like USDC experience 0.15-0.25 daily velocity with deep liquidity in multiple countries, maintaining pegs through market crashes including 2022's crypto winter.

Mitigation:

  • Use only top-tier stablecoins with transparent reserves

  • Short exposure windows (2-5 days) minimize tail risk

  • Automated monitoring with instant liquidation triggers

  • Diversification across stablecoin types for large volumes

DeFi Yield Volatility

Yield-bearing stablecoins grew 13x from $660M (August 2023) to $9B (May 2025), representing 4% of total stablecoin market with potential to reach 50%.

Current Environment (2025):

  • Aave USDC lending: 5-7% APY

  • Compound: 4-6% APY

  • Drift Protocol: 6-9% APY

  • Traditional accounts: 0.4-0.5% APY

Even in compressed environments, the spread versus traditional banking remains 10-15x.

Smart Contract Security

Modern DeFi leverages battle-tested protocols processing hundreds of billions with professional audits.

Due Diligence:

  • Use only $1B+ TVL protocols

  • Require multiple security audits

  • Verify bug bounty programs

  • Confirm insurance availability

  • Monitor real-time protocol health
